It's a Meishan pig, originally bred in Jiangsu province.

They're all pretty ugly, but this guy is even uglier than usual.

You can blame human intervention in their breeding as well as overfeeding, in this case.

Edit: I fell down a research black hole. Wikipedia says Meishan county, but there is no Meishan County I can find in Jiangsu (only Sichuan, which is a long way away). Another source says it was named after "Meishan lake", by which I assume they mean Weishan lake. Perhaps there are some transliteration issues here.

Also to add the Meishan Pig may be ugly but it's hyper prolific genes are very valuable to breeder companies where they include Meishan Pig in their genetics program

A typical Hybrid pig only has an average of 16 (depending on the breed) piglets
But a Meishan pig can have an average of 30 or more

Use the chinese version of the wikipedia page and then your browser's translate feature: https://zh.wikipedia.org/wiki/梅山猪

Meishan pig is a family pig breed in China. It belongs to a group of Taihu pig. It is native to Jiading District, Shanghai, Taicang, Kunshan and other places in Jiangsu Province. It is mainly distributed on both sides of the Liu River. Meishan pig has been exported to …. among which France, Japan and the United States have all studied it systematically.

Originally, there were three types of plum mountain pigs, namely small plum mountain pigs (commonly known as "Chaoban Face"), large-armed pigs (commonly known as "camel feet"), and horse-based type (commonly known as "wooden fish head"). After continuous hybridization and selection among various types, from the 1960s to the 1970s, there were two types of medium-sized plum wild boar …
